Benin – Reform of the status of contract teachers: the government reinforces their integration

President Patrice Talon intends to improve conditions for government contract teachers. Meeting in the Council of Ministers on Wednesday March 26, the government adopted a decree amending and supplementing the provisions of decree no. 2023-373 of July 19, 2023.

This measure concerns contract teachers who have passed the diagnostic evaluation, and is designed to provide a framework for their integration into the civil service.

According to the Council’s minutes, this amendment is intended to facilitate the transition of the teachers concerned and guarantee a more structured reversion process. By reinforcing their status, the Beninese executive is pursuing its reforms to professionalize the teaching profession.

The decree is part of an overall drive to modernize public administration and improve working conditions for civil servants.

By securing their status, the government confirms its commitment to more effective educational governance and sustainable development of human capital.
